And what researchers are discovering is nothing short of remarkable.<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><b>The Story Behind the Black Pearl<\/b><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">In ancient times, Karuppu Kavuni rice was so prized that it was reserved exclusively for royalty and served during important ceremonies. Some historical accounts suggest it was even used as tribute to emperors. The deep black-purple color wasn&#8217;t just aesthetically pleasing; it was a visible sign of the rice&#8217;s extraordinary nutritional power.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The name itself tells a story. &#8220;Karuppu&#8221; means black in Tamil, and &#8220;Kavuni&#8221; refers to a specific type of traditional rice variety. In some regions, it&#8217;s also called &#8220;Forbidden Rice,&#8221; not because it was banned, but because in ancient China, black rice was forbidden to anyone outside the imperial family. Only the emperor and his court could enjoy its benefits.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Fast forward to today, and this once-exclusive grain is making a comeback in kitchens across India. But unlike its royal past, Karuppu Kavuni is now accessible to anyone who wants to experience its incredible health benefits.<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><b>What Makes Karuppu Kavuni Different?<\/b><\/h2>\n<h3><b>The Power of Anthocyanins<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">That striking dark color isn&#8217;t just for show. The deep purple-black hue comes from anthocyanins, the same powerful antioxidants found in blueberries, blackberries, and purple grapes. In fact, Karuppu Kavuni contains more anthocyanins than most berries, gram for gram.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Anthocyanins are known for their ability to fight inflammation, protect against heart disease, and even slow down the aging process. When you eat black rice, you&#8217;re essentially eating a grain that acts like a superfruit.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b>Nutritional Powerhouse<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Let&#8217;s break down what you&#8217;re actually getting in each serving of Karuppu Kavuni:<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><b>Nutritional Comparison Table (Per 100g Cooked Rice)<\/b><\/h4>\n<table>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td><b>Nutrient<\/b><\/td>\n<td><b>Karuppu Kavuni (Black Rice)<\/b><\/td>\n<td><b>White Rice<\/b><\/td>\n<td><b>Brown Rice<\/b><\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td><b>Calories<\/b><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">356 kcal<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">130 kcal<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">370 kcal<\/span><\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td><b>Protein<\/b><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">8.5g<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">2.7g<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">7.9g<\/span><\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td><b>Fiber<\/b><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">4.9g<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">0.4g<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">2.8g<\/span><\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td><b>Iron<\/b><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">3.5mg<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">0.2mg<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">1.8mg<\/span><\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td><b>Calcium<\/b><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">23mg<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">10mg<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">23mg<\/span><\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td><b>Anthocyanins<\/b><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">327mg<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">0mg<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Trace<\/span><\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td><b>Vitamin E<\/b><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">2.4mg<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">0.1mg<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">1.2mg<\/span><\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td><b>Zinc<\/b><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">2.02mg<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">0.49mg<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">1.4mg<\/span><\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td><b>Antioxidants (ORAC)<\/b><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">7,400<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">1,100<\/span><\/td>\n<td><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">2,200<\/span><\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table>\n<p><b>Note: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> ORAC (Oxygen Radical Absorbance Capacity) measures antioxidant levels. Powerful Diabetes Management<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Remember that glycemic index we talked about? Karuppu Kavuni has a GI of just 42-45, making it one of the lowest among all rice varieties. But the benefits go beyond just slow sugar release.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Studies have shown that the anthocyanins in black rice can actually improve insulin sensitivity. This means your body becomes better at using the insulin it produces, which is crucial for both preventing and managing type 2 diabetes.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The high fiber content (more than 12 times that of white rice) also slows down carbohydrate absorption, preventing those dangerous blood sugar spikes that diabetics need to avoid.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Real-world impact: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Many people who switch to Karuppu Kavuni report more stable energy levels throughout the day and better post-meal blood sugar readings.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b>2. Heart Health Protection<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Your heart will thank you for choosing black rice. Here&#8217;s why:<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The anthocyanins in Karuppu Kavuni have been shown to reduce LDL (bad) cholesterol oxidation. When LDL cholesterol oxidizes, it becomes more likely to stick to artery walls, leading to plaque buildup and heart disease. By preventing this oxidation, black rice helps keep your arteries clear and healthy.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Additionally, black rice contains plant compounds that can help reduce inflammation in blood vessels and improve overall cardiovascular function.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b>3. A healthy gut is linked to better immunity, improved mood, and even better weight management.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Many people also find that black rice is easier to digest than wheat or other grains, making it a good option for those with sensitive digestive systems.<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><b>How to Cook Karuppu Kavuni Rice Perfectly<\/b><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Black rice has a slightly different cooking process than white rice. Here&#8217;s how to get it just right:<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b>1. Basic Cooking Method<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><b>Ingredients:<\/b><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">1 cup Karuppu Kavuni rice<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">2.5 cups water<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Pinch of salt (optional)<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><b>Steps:<\/b><\/p>\n<ol>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Rinse thoroughly: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Wash the rice 2-3 times until the water runs clearer. Don&#8217;t worry if the water stays slightly purple; that&#8217;s the anthocyanins, and you want to keep those!<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Soak (recommended):<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> For best results, soak the rice for 4-6 hours or overnight. This reduces cooking time and makes the rice easier to digest. If you&#8217;re short on time, even 30 minutes of soaking helps.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Cook: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Combine rice and water in a pot.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to low, cover, and simmer for 30-35 minutes (or 20-25 minutes if pre-soaked).<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Rest: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Once cooked, turn off the heat and let it sit covered for 10 minutes. This allows the rice to absorb any remaining water and become perfectly fluffy.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Fluff and serve: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Gently fluff with a fork and enjoy!<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<h3><b>2. Pressure Cooker Method<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If you&#8217;re using a pressure cooker (much faster!):<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Use a 1:2 ratio of rice to water<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Cook for 2 whistles on medium heat<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Let pressure release naturally<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3><b>Pro Tips for Perfect Black Rice<\/b><\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Don&#8217;t oversoak: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> More than 8 hours of soaking can make the rice mushy<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Save the purple water: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> If you drain any excess water after cooking, save it! It&#8217;s packed with anthocyanins and can be used in smoothies or soups<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Texture preference: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> For softer rice, add a bit more water. For separate, fluffy grains, stick to the 1:2.5 ratio<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Cooking with coconut milk: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Replace half the water with coconut milk for a creamy, slightly sweet variation<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2><b>Delicious Ways to Enjoy Karuppu Kavuni<\/b><\/h2>\n<h3><b>1. Traditional Sweet Preparation<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><b>Karuppu Kavuni Payasam (Black Rice Pudding)<\/b><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This is how black rice is traditionally enjoyed in South India during festivals.<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Cook black rice until soft<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Add jaggery or coconut sugar while warm<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Mix in coconut milk and cardamom powder<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Garnish with roasted cashews and raisins<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Serve warm or chilled<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The natural nuttiness of black rice pairs beautifully with the sweetness of jaggery and the richness of coconut milk.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b>2. Modern Savory Dishes<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><b>Black Rice Bowl:<\/b><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Base of cooked Karuppu Kavuni<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Top with roasted vegetables (sweet potato, broccoli, bell peppers)<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Add chickpeas or grilled tofu for protein<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Drizzle with tahini or peanut sauce<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Sprinkle with sesame seeds<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><b>Black Rice Salad:<\/b><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Cool cooked black rice completely<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Mix with diced cucumber, tomatoes, and red onion<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Add fresh herbs like cilantro and mint<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Dress with lemon juice, olive oil, salt, and pepper<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Optional: add pomegranate seeds for extra antioxidants<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><b>Black Rice Upma:<\/b><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Use cooked black rice instead of semolina<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Temper with mustard seeds, curry leaves, and green chilies<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Add vegetables of your choice<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">A healthy twist on a South Indian breakfast classic<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><b>Karuppu Kavuni Pongal:<\/b><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Replace regular rice with black rice<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Cook with moong dal, pepper, cumin, and ghee<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The nutty flavor of black rice adds a new dimension to this comfort food<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3><b>Breakfast Ideas<\/b><\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Black Rice Porridge: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Cook with almond milk, topped with berries and nuts<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Black Rice Dosa: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Grind soaked black rice with urad dal for a nutritious breakfast crepe<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Black Rice Idli: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Mix with regular idli rice for a colorful, nutritious twist<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2><b>Buying and Storing Guide<\/b><\/h2>\n<h3><b>What to Look For<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">When buying Karuppu Kavuni rice, quality matters:<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Color: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Should be deep black with a purple tinge. Any musty or off smell is a red flag.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Certification: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Look for organic certification and FSSAI approval to ensure the rice is free from pesticides and properly processed.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Source: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Choose rice sourced directly from farmers or reputable organic suppliers who can verify authenticity.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b>Storage Tips<\/b><\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Store in an airtight container in a cool, dry place<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Keeps well for 6-12 months when properly stored<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Avoid exposure to moisture, which can lead to mold<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Don&#8217;t mix old and new batches<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If storing for longer periods, refrigeration can extend shelf life<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3><b>Common Concerns<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><b>&#8220;Why is it so expensive?&#8221;<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Karuppu Kavuni is more expensive than regular rice for several reasons. It has a longer growing season, lower yield per acre, and requires specific soil conditions. Plus, it&#8217;s typically grown organically by small farmers using traditional methods. You&#8217;re paying for quality, nutritional value, and supporting sustainable farming practices.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>&#8220;Is all black rice the same?&#8221;<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Not all black rice is Karuppu Kavuni. There are different varieties of black rice across Asia. Karuppu Kavuni is specifically the South Indian variety and has unique characteristics. Some sellers might label any black rice as Karuppu Kavuni, so buy from trusted sources.<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><b>Who Should Eat Karuppu Kavuni?<\/b><\/h2>\n<h3><b>Ideal For:<\/b><\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Diabetics: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Low GI and blood sugar management benefits<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Heart health conscious: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Cholesterol management and cardiovascular protection<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Weight watchers: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> High satiety and metabolic benefits<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Athletes: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Sustained energy and good protein content<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Anyone seeking anti-aging benefits: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Powerful antioxidants<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>People with digestive issues: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> High fiber and easy to digest<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Those transitioning to healthier eating: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Familiar rice format with superior nutrition<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3><b>Considerations:<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">While Karuppu Kavuni is generally safe and beneficial for most people, keep these points in mind: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Introduce gradually: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> If you&#8217;re used to white rice, your digestive system might need time to adjust to the higher fiber content<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Portion awareness: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Even healthy foods should be eaten in moderation.
